    Well, again I mostly agree. But history, I think, demonstrates without a doubt that no amount of social conditioning will change the sexual behavior of people. The only thing that has any apparent effect for controlling population growth is raising the living standard of the population. More affluent populations have fewer children. Check it out. Raising populations out of poverty has nothing but positive effects for everyone, as far as I can tell.
